Course details
Computer Vision: This unit focuses on the role of computer vision in autonomous vehicles, including object detection, tracking, and recognition, as well as scene understanding and mapping. •
Machine Learning: This unit explores the application of machine learning algorithms in autonomous vehicles, including predictive maintenance, anomaly detection, and decision-making. •
Sensor Fusion: This unit delves into the integration of various sensors, such as cameras, lidar, radar, and GPS, to create a comprehensive and accurate perception system for autonomous vehicles. •
Autonomous Driving Software: This unit covers the development of software for autonomous vehicles, including control algorithms, mapping, and decision-making, as well as cybersecurity and testing. •
5G and Edge Computing: This unit examines the role of 5G networks and edge computing in enabling the widespread adoption of autonomous vehicles, including reduced latency and increased data processing capabilities. •
Autonomous Vehicle Architecture: This unit explores the design and development of autonomous vehicle architectures, including the integration of hardware and software components, as well as testing and validation. •
Cybersecurity for Autonomous Vehicles: This unit focuses on the security risks associated with autonomous vehicles and provides strategies for mitigating these risks, including secure communication protocols and intrusion detection systems. •
Autonomous Vehicle Regulations: This unit covers the regulatory frameworks governing the development and deployment of autonomous vehicles, including safety standards, liability, and testing requirements. •
Trends in Autonomous Vehicle Technology: This unit examines the latest trends and advancements in autonomous vehicle technology, including the use of artificial intelligence, computer vision, and sensor fusion. •
Autonomous Vehicle Business Models: This unit explores the various business models for autonomous vehicles, including ride-hailing, trucking, and mobility-as-a-service, as well as the role of autonomous vehicles in urban planning and development.

Job Market Trends and Demand in the UK
| **Career Role** | Description | Industry Relevance |
|---|---|---|
| Software Engineer | Designs and develops software for autonomous vehicles, including computer vision and machine learning algorithms. | High demand for software engineers with expertise in computer vision, machine learning, and programming languages like Python and C++. |
| Data Scientist | Analyzes data from various sources to improve autonomous vehicle performance, including sensor data and GPS information. | High demand for data scientists with expertise in machine learning, statistics, and programming languages like Python and R. |
| Autonomous Vehicle Engineer | Designs and develops autonomous vehicle systems, including sensor systems, control systems, and software. | High demand for engineers with expertise in mechanical engineering, electrical engineering, and computer science. |
| Computer Vision Engineer | Develops algorithms and software for computer vision applications in autonomous vehicles, including object detection and tracking. | High demand for engineers with expertise in computer vision, machine learning, and programming languages like Python and C++. |
